Hi Im a new member and after some advice please.
My background is breast cancer aged 38, where my periods stopped during treatment.
I'm now 48 yrs old and Ive had regular 26-day-cycle periods for the last 6 years or so, however I am now 11 days late ( Im not pregnant)  and although I dont think Ive been suddenly plunged in to the menopause ?, my question is ..
 Is it normal to get period-pain cramping and yet no period?
  Ive had quite strong period pains for the past 11 days ,  yet nothing to show for it!

Morning! In early peri I found my pmt and cramps would arrive at the ‘expected’ time and then I would stay like that until the bleed arrived. Sometimes this meant pmt and mild cramps for 2-3 weeks. It felt like my body was trying really hard to have a period but couldn’t quite make it.
